Marcelo Flores 'on verge of permanent Arsenal exit'

Nineteen-year-old Arsenal protege Marcelo Flores is reportedly on the verge of joining Mexican side Tigres in a permanent deal worth £2m.

Arsenal protege Marcelo Flores is reportedly on the verge of sealing a permanent exit from North London to Mexican outfit Tigres.

The 19-year-old was once hailed as one of the most promising prospects in the Hale End academy, but it has ultimately not worked out for him in North London.

The former Ipswich Town youth product was sent out to Real Oviedo on loan for the 2022-23 season in order to gain more first-team experience, but he made just 15 appearances for the Spanish second-tier club, registering one assist.

Flores only made seven league starts for Real Oviedo and was an unused substitute in a further 27 matches, as well as failing to earn any minutes in their Copa del Rey third-round defeat to Atletico Madrid.

Since returning to Arsenal, the Mexico international has not been considered for first-team selection by Mikel Arteta and has made just four substitute appearances for the Under-21s in the Premier League 2 and EFL Trophy.

Flores remains contracted to the Gunners for another two years, but according to the Evening Standard, the 2003-born starlet will soon bid farewell to North London as he returns to his homeland.

The report adds that Arsenal have agreed to sell Flores to Tigres in a £2m deal, and the attacker will pen a four-year deal with the Mexican giants after completing a medical.

Arsenal stood to lose Flores this year before activating a two-year extension in his contract, but having failed to make a first-team breakthrough, he is moving onto pastures new.

"Happy with this new stage and ready to start the new stage with the best club in Mexico," the publication quotes Flores as telling journalists upon his arrival in Mexico earlier this week.

Flores left the Ipswich academy in 2019 to join Arsenal and was a star of the Under-18 setup upon his arrival, scoring 10 goals and setting up five more in 32 appearances at that level.

Following promotion to the Under-21 team, Flores scored another five goals in 16 matches and was included in Arteta's squad for the first time in their 3-0 loss to Crystal Palace in April 2022.

The Mexican did not earn any minutes at Selhurst Park and was not called up to the first team again, although he did make fleeting pre-season appearances and has already played three times for the senior Mexico team.

Flores is poised to leave Arsenal at the same time as Nicolas Pepe, who has been officially unveiled by Trabzonspor as their latest signing following a mediocre four-year spell in North London.

The Turkish side shared images of Pepe donning the Trabzonspor jersey on a private jet as he travelled to complete his transfer, which is expected to be finalised on Friday assuming he passes his medical.

However, it is unknown whether the Ivory Coast international's contract - which was due to expire next year - has been terminated or if the Gunners have managed to recoup a nominal fee for their £72m attacker.
